1904, two of the members present at the original meeting in 1884 were still active as officials — the Chairman, Sir Paul Chater, and the Secretary, Mr John Grant. A race book of that year gives us a complete list of officials. Sir Paul Chater was also the Judge.
1892-1926, Sir Catchick Paul CHATER serving the longest term of HKJC chairmanship.
